The veterinary practice of Dr. Anja Peters in Berlin's composer district offers dedicated and professionally sound care for small pets. Equipped with state-of-the-art diagnostics such as digital X-ray and ultrasound, as well as an in-house laboratory, the experienced team ensures comprehensive medical attention. Pet owners particularly value the calm, warm atmosphere and the detailed advice provided for every health concern. The well-being of each four-legged patient is always placed at the forefront here.
